Physician Assistant - NYP Medical Group Brooklyn - Neurology

The Neurology PA is an integral part of the care team. This PA will have the opportunity to learn and develop a multitude of neurology skills and procedures. Take advantage of this opportunity to advance your knowledge base and skills while working in a dynamic group. Transform lives, and channel your potential in a fast paced, high quality, clinical setting. Establishes a presumptive diagnosis and performs a general work-up including the ordering of appropriate laboratory studies. Under supervision, is responsible for the patient's medical issues following the diagnosis.

This is full time day (Monday/Friday - hours will depend on provider) position at NYP Medical Group Brooklyn located at 263 7th Avenue, Brooklyn, NY. May be required to cover at other locations within Brooklyn Medical Group.

Preferred Criteria

  • One year of inpatient experience
  • Experienced Physician Assistant within a Neurology patient care setting
Required Criteria
  • Bachelor's Degree or equivalent experience
  • Degree or major in Certified Physician Assistant
  • Licensure as a Physician's Assistant by the State of New York
  • National Commission Certified Physician Assistant (NCCPA)
